currently when you click on a script and you chose 'run in terminal' it immediately closes after the exit. However the window should stay open because:
- when you select 'run in terminal', you want to see the output of the script. Else you could run it without a terminal right?
- on error the window closes immediately and you cannot see any error messages. In use case 1) I could add a read at the end of the script. This will not work here.
There could also be an option 'keep window open', but I cannot think about a case where you want the terminal to close immediately when the script exits.
